4. Sophie Turner Sophie Turner Actress, Hardhome Sophie Turner was born in Northampton in England and grew up in Warwick. She attended Kings High School there and was a member of a local theatre group from a young age. Her breakthrough role was as Sansa Stark in the HBO hit series Game of Thrones.

13. Lily James Lily James Actress, Cinderella James was born in Esher, Surrey. Her father is actor and musician Jamie Thomson, and her grandmother, Helen Horton, was an American actress. She began her education at Arts Educational School in Tring and subsequently went on to study acting at the Guildhall School of Music and Drama in London, graduating in 2010.

48. Idris Elba Idris Elba Actor, Pacific Rim Idris Elba is an English television, theatre, and film actor. An only child, he was born and raised in Hackney, London. His father, Winston, is from Sierra Leone and worked at a Ford car factory. His mother, Eve, is from Ghana and did clerical work. Idris went to school in Canning Town, where he first became involved in acting...
